UNCASVILLE, Connecticut Abraham Montoya made the most of his opportunity against an undefeated prospect in a televised fight Wednesday night. The Mexican veteran threw exactly 1,000 punches and out-worked Alejandro Guerrero to win their eight-round lightweight bout by majority decision. Judge Glenn Feldman scored their action-packed encounter even (76-76), but John McKaie (79-73) and Steve Weisfeld (77-75) credited Montoya for his activity and harder punches in the opener of a "ShoBox: The New Generation" tripleheader at Mohegan Sun Arena.
